Comprehending Conservatories

Before diving into the selection of a conservatory builder, it's essential to comprehend what a conservatory is and the different types available.

Types of Conservatories

Type of ConservatoryDescription
VictorianCharacterized by elaborate information and a multi-faceted roofing system, Victorian conservatories are ageless and include a stylish touch to any home.
EdwardianThese conservatories feature a more rectangle-shaped shape, maximizing floor space and often showcasing a simple, timeless design.
Lean-ToPerfect for homes with restricted space, lean-to conservatories have a single-pitched roof and are ideal for modern homes.
Gable-FrontedOffering conventional beauty, these structures feature a gable roof and high ceilings, offering a grand and roomy feel.
OrangeriesCombining a conservatory with brick walls, orangeries offer a more solid structure and can function as an extension of the living space.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Conservatory Builder

Discovering the best conservatory builder can be intimidating. Here are a number of factors to consider:

1. Track record and Reviews

Before devoting, research study the builder's reputation. Look for evaluations on platforms like Google, Yelp, or specialized construction evaluation sites. Ask for reviews from past customers to evaluate customer satisfaction.

2. Portfolio of Previous Work

Examining a builder's previous tasks can provide insight into their style and workmanship. A lot of contractors have portfolios or galleries available on their sites.

3. Accreditations and Insurance

Ensure the builder has the necessary accreditations and insurance. This protects you from liability in case of mishaps throughout construction and ensures compliance with market standards.

4. Interaction Skills

A builder needs to display exceptional communication skills, responding to questions and explaining the procedure plainly. Good interaction ensures that your vision is understood and performed.

5. Rates and Transparency

While expense shouldn't be the only element, it's vital to get quotes from numerous builders. Try to find transparency in pricing to prevent unforeseen expenses later.

6. Timeline and Availability

Talk about the predicted timeline for your conservatory job. Ensure that the builder can accommodate your schedule which they have the resources to finish the task on time.

7. Aftercare and Maintenance

An excellent builder will not simply complete the task and leave; they ought to use aftercare services and supply guidance on preserving your brand-new conservatory.

Common FAQs About Conservatory Builders

Q1: How much does it cost to build a conservatory?

The expense can vary significantly depending upon size, style, materials, and place. Usually, a conservatory can cost from ₤ 5,000 to over ₤ 30,000.

Q2: How long does it take to build a conservatory?

Generally, the construction of a conservatory can take anywhere from 4 to 12 weeks, depending on the intricacy of the design and any potential regulatory approvals required.

Q3: Do I need planning authorization for a conservatory?

In a lot of cases, conservatories fall under allowed advancement guidelines, but this can vary by location. It's recommended to inspect with the local council or your builder.

Q4: Can I utilize my conservatory year-round?

Yes, with the best insulation and heating choices, a conservatory can be taken pleasure in throughout the year.

Q5: What is the very best product for a conservatory?

Common materials include uPVC, aluminum, and wood. Each has its own set of advantages and disadvantages, so your option might depend upon visual preferences and budget.
